Demonstrating Entitlement to Cumulative Impact Claims

How to turn a blizzard of small changes into a defensible disruption claim — the seven elements of entitlement, the Measured Mile, and the quantification methods tribunals actually accept.

What a cumulative impact claim is

A cumulative impact claim argues that a large number of individual changes — each perhaps minor on its own — combined to disrupt productivity far beyond the sum of their direct costs. The claim is for the ripple effect: lost efficiency, trade stacking, dilution of supervision and out-of-sequence work that no single change order captured.

It is the hardest delay-and-disruption claim to win, because the loss is real but diffuse. Tribunals treat these claims sceptically, so entitlement must be demonstrated, not asserted — with a clear causal chain from the volume of change to a measurable loss of productivity.

Local impact vs. cumulative impact

Local impact is the direct, traceable cost of a single change — the added labour and materials for that scope, usually priced in the change order itself. Cumulative impact is the synergistic disruption that the interaction of many changes inflicts on the wider work: re-planning, congestion, learning-curve losses and morale. By definition it is not captured in any one change order, which is exactly why a separate claim is needed — and why owners argue it was already "released" when each change was priced.

The seven elements of entitlement

Think of a cumulative impact case as a chain — it is only as strong as its weakest link. To establish entitlement you generally must show all seven:

  1. Numerous changes. A volume of changes large enough that disruption is plausible, not a handful.
  2. Owner responsibility. The changes were directed by, or are the contractual risk of, the owner.
  3. Beyond contemplation. The number and timing exceeded what a reasonable contractor allowed for at bid.
  4. Impact on unchanged work. The changes disrupted the productivity of work that was not itself changed.
  5. Measurable loss. A productivity loss that can be quantified by an accepted method.
  6. Distinguishable cause. The loss is separable from contractor-caused inefficiency and concurrent owner/third-party causes.
  7. Notice & reservation. Timely notice was given and rights to cumulative impact were reserved (not waived in change-order releases).

Proving causation: the Measured Mile

The most defensible method compares a clean, unimpacted period of the same work against the impacted period — the Measured Mile. Because both samples share the same crew, scope and conditions, the change environment is the only material difference, which is what makes the comparison persuasive and hard to attack.

Pick the mile carefully: it must be genuinely unimpacted (not merely "less bad"), representative of the work, and large enough to be statistically meaningful.

Worked example

An unimpacted "mile" of the work installed 12.5 units/day. During the heavily-changed period the same crew installed only 8.0 units/day.

Loss factor = (12.5 − 8.0) ÷ 12.5 = 36%. Applied to the 1,900 labour-hours worked in the impacted window, the inefficiency is ≈ 684 hours of compensable lost productivity — before markup. Note we apply the factor to hours actually worked in the impacted window, not to the whole job.

Other quantification methods

When no clean mile exists, fall back — in roughly this order of credibility:

  • Baseline / earned-value comparison — compare planned vs. earned productivity across the job, isolating the impacted scope.
  • Comparable project studies — your own unimpacted projects of similar scope.
  • Industry productivity studies — MCAA, NECA, the Leonard/Ibbs change-impact curves — used to corroborate, not to replace, project-specific proof.
  • Modified total cost — a last resort, and only after pricing out contractor-caused and unrelated overruns.

Ten things to remember

  1. Cumulative impact is about the interaction of changes, not their direct cost.
  2. Entitlement is a seven-link chain — prove every link.
  3. Reserve cumulative-impact rights in every change order.
  4. The Measured Mile is your strongest proof — protect a clean window.
  5. The mile must be the same work, crew and conditions.
  6. Apply the loss factor to hours worked in the impacted window.
  7. Distinguish owner-caused loss from your own and from concurrent causes.
  8. Use industry studies to corroborate, never to replace, project data.
  9. Treat total cost as a last resort, and modify it.
  10. Contemporaneous records win cases — daily reports, manpower curves, photos.

Bringing it together

A cumulative impact claim succeeds when a tribunal can follow an unbroken line from "the owner changed the work this many times, this late" to "and here is the measured productivity those changes cost." Build that line with contemporaneous records and the Measured Mile, reserve your rights along the way, and quantify with a method the tribunal already trusts.

Glossary

Baseline productivity
The output rate the contractor achieved (or reasonably planned) absent owner-caused disruption, used as the comparison datum.
Concurrent cause
An independent cause of loss operating in the same period; entitlement requires separating owner-caused loss from concurrent contractor or third-party causes.
Cumulative impact
The compounded loss of efficiency arising from the interaction of many individual changes, beyond the direct cost of each change order taken alone.
Disruption
A loss of productivity on work that was not itself changed, caused by the manner or timing in which other work was changed.
Local impact
The direct, traceable cost of a single change — the added labour and materials for that scope, usually priced in the change order itself.
Measured Mile
A productivity-comparison method that contrasts an unimpacted period of work against an impacted period of the same scope, crew and conditions to isolate the loss caused by the change environment.
Modified total cost method
A quantification of last resort: total overrun adjusted to remove contractor-caused inefficiency and unrelated cost growth before attribution to the owner.
Productivity loss factor
The proportional drop in output, (unimpacted rate − impacted rate) ÷ unimpacted rate, applied to impacted labour-hours to size the inefficiency.
